Heroku, a part of the Salesforce Platform, is a container-based service for developers to deploy, manage, and scale modern apps. Heroku is elegant, flexible, and easy to use, offering developers the simplest path to getting their apps to market. As a fully managed service, it gives developers the freedom to focus on their core product without the distraction of maintaining servers, hardware, or infrastructure. The Heroku experience provides services, tools, workflows, and polyglot support — all designed to enhance developer productivity. What is included in PaaS?

PaaS provides customers with everything they need to build and manage applications. These tools can be accessed over the internet through a browser, regardless of physical location. The specific software development tools often include but are not limited to a debugger, source code editor and a compiler. These platforms offer compute and storage infrastructures, as well as text editing, version management, compiling and testing services that help developers create new software quickly and efficiently. A PaaS product can also enable development teams to collaborate and work together, regardless of their physical location.
